On the housing front, median rent in Fraser is $1,658/month compared to $272/month in Walsh — a 510%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: Walsh is more affordable at $82,100 median vs $593,800.

Median household income in Fraser is $81,786 compared to $21,711 in Walsh (+276.7%). While Fraser is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Fraser spend roughly 24.3% of their income on rent, more than the 15% in Walsh.
